English : Using unclassical feedstuffs in fish nutrition
Arabic : استخدام أعلاف غير تقليدية في تغذية الأسماك
Abstract The present study was conducted at Department of the Wastes Recycling, Animal Production Research Institute ( APRI). Egypt. The objective was to study the performance of Tilapia as affected by replacing fishmeal by poultry by-product meal at 25,50, 75 and 100% level, and replacing soybean meal by leucaena seeds at levels of 20, 30, 40 and 50% of SBM each alone. Then after, another experiment was carried out to evaluate the economical using of a practical diet in which poultry by-product meal and leucaena seeds replaced fishmeal and soybean meal by 12.5% and 25%, respectively, together, compared with a control diet of tilapia fingerlings. The results showed that increasing leucaena seeds level in the diet tend to increase to crude fiber content but did not affect the nutritive value of the formulated diets. Tilapia fingerlings received poultry by - product meal at 25% of fish meal level and those having leucaena seeds at 50% of SBM recorded the- higher live bodyweight and the best growth rate. In addition, fingerlings of these treatments recorded the best findings of FCR. PER, PPV. EER and the cheapest feed cost to produce unit of fish gain. Using poultry by - product meal and leucaena seeds together to substitute 12.5%, of fish meal and 25%, of SBM, decreased tile cost of feed formulation by 100 L.E / ton than the control diet. Moreover, the feed cost required to produce one kg fish gain was lower than the control diet by 25.57%. Accordingly, the use of poultry by- product meal and leucaena seeds meal together was more efficient and economically better than using each alone in tilapia fish diets.
